This is workbook teaches children how to develop the cognitive skills that will help them to cope with daily adversity. Each lesson in this mental health "wizard class" explains a different type of "Stinking Thinking" - from ignoring the big picture to making a big (or little) deal out of something - and teaches children how to spot and combat it.

Autorenporträt
Joann Altiero, Ph.D., is a child clinical psychologist who received her doctorate from Southern Illinois University. She has worked in the field of clinical psychology for over 20 years, is a faculty member at the University of Maryland University College and has had a successful private practice promoting family mental health in La Plata, MD, since 1998.
